Youth Pastor – Chinese Presbyterian Church of Oakland, CA

Posted by sedwardyang on November 10, 2007

CHINESE PRESBYTERIAN CHURCH OF OAKLAND
JOB DESCRIPTION
FOR
Youth Pastor

REQUIREMENT:

At the beginning, this is a part-time (Halftime 20 hours per week) position. If the staff person proof himself /herself that he/she is capable to develop this program. The call will change to full time position. We require the staff person be a graduate from seminaries recognized by the Presbyterian Church (U.S.A), or seminarian who is studying in seminaries recognized by the PCUSA and preferably a bilingual person: Chinese and English. This person should be a mature and dedicated Christian, who can perform assigned duties with minimum supervision. Yet, he/she is accountable to the Pastor and to the Session.

RESPONSIBILITY:

1. To plan, develop, organize, implement, direct and supervise the EBAYOM program (East Bay Asian Youth Outreach Ministry).
2. To develop and organize youth programs, including weekly meetings such as (Youth program on Friday evenings, and activities on Saturday.) Once a week on a weekday, he/she is required to be present at the Church during the after school program to supervise the teaching staff of the EBAYOM program.
3. To research and submit applications to various income sources.
4. To coordinate and supervise the Summer School which is held 8 weeks from 9:00 A.M. to 5:15 P.M. during the weekdays.
5. To provide leadership, guidance and counseling to the Church Sunday School.
6. To assist the pastor if necessary in carrying out his duties for the Church, including but not limited to delivering sermon occasionally, leading worship service, and attending meetings.

REMUNERATION:

1. Annual salary of $28,000, including FICA, pension and medical.
2. Housing and auto allowance of $10,000.
3. Paid vacation of 2 weeks.
